Consider Refinancing
The Coronavirus Crisis has put the housing market in a unique situation. Few people are selling homes yet interest rates are at an all-time low, bringing millions of buyers and investors out of the woodwork. The high demand and low supply of houses have caused home prices to skyrocket. This is good news if you already own a house because your property value has probably increased in the last year.
The record-low interest rates make it an ideal time to refinance. Lowering your interest rate by even .5% can lower your monthly mortgage payment by hundreds of dollars. Many banks are even offering no-cost refinancing, which makes refinancing your home a no-brainer.
Saving hundreds of dollars every month by refinancing your mortgage loan could really help ease the stress and burden of homeownership.
Look Into Selling
Selling could be a great option if refinancing won’t give you enough cash to ease the stress. Many sellers in today’s market are getting several offers on their home within days of listing. Beware that even if you get an offer quickly, COVID-19 has slowed down a lot of the mortgage processes so closing may take longer than expected.
The downside to selling now is that you’ll need to buy or rent in the same market that you’re selling in. You’ll probably pay a pretty penny for a new home, but there are still benefits to selling and buying now. When you buy a new home you typically don’t make a mortgage payment in the first month, which could buy you valuable time to recoup some of the cash you need to cover your living expenses.
